Biomarkers Market Dynamics
Segments
- Based on type, the global biomarkers market can be categorized into predictive, prognostic, pharmacodynamic, and diagnostic biomarkers. Predictive biomarkers are used to predict how a patient will respond to a particular treatment, while prognostic biomarkers indicate the likely outcome of a disease. Pharmacodynamic biomarkers measure the effect of a drug on the body, and diagnostic biomarkers are used to identify specific diseases or conditions.
- On the basis of application, the biomarkers market is segmented into oncology, cardiovascular diseases, neurological disorders, immunological disorders, and others. Biomarkers play a crucial role in early detection, diagnosis, and monitoring of various diseases, thereby contributing to personalized medicine and improved patient outcomes.
- By product type, the market can be divided into consumables, services, and software. Consumables include reagents, kits, and other biomarker-related products essential for research and diagnostic purposes. Services cover biomarker testing and analysis services, while software includes data analysis and management tools for biomarker research.
- Geographically, the global biomarkers market is segmented into North America, Europe, Asia Pacific, Latin America, and the Middle East & Africa. North America dominates the market due to the presence of advanced healthcare infrastructure, significant R&D investments, and a high prevalence of chronic diseases. However, the Asia Pacific region is expected to witness rapid growth attributed to increasing healthcare expenditure, rising awareness about personalized medicine, and expanding biopharmaceutical industry.
